What is NYC FC § 2407.4.2?

Quick Answer

This section mandates the posting of durable signs in process zones to indicate dangers related to fire and accidents, restrict access to qualified personnel, specify grounding requirements for electrically conductive objects, and denote the maximum potential sparking distance. Applies to building owners managing hazardous areas.

2407.4.2 Signage.

FC § 2407.4.2

Durable signs that provide the following cautions and information shall be conspicuously posted: 1. Designate the process zone as dangerous with respect to fire and accident.

2.Restrict access to qualified personnel only.

3.Indicate the grounding requirements for all electrically conductive objects in the flammable vapor area, including persons working in that area.

4.Indicates the maximum potential sparking distance as set forth in FC 2407.2.
